Minor point, but at a certain point, or contact point changes from the end of the handle to almost the middle. That would change the amount of force being applied.
Yes but it doesn't really matter, when you are beyond that point you are most likely just bending the handle or more likely, stuff inside the mechanism are beginning to break. You can see it because the kg metrics flatlines (stays the same) before that happens. Even the bacho, you can see just when it is horizontal that something gived away in the head because it moves.

Something to note: the brand of a tool does not necessarily indicate where a tool was actually made. For instance, the only company that I am aware of that makes ratching socket wrenches in Japan is Ko-Ken Tools. Makita makes their tools in either Taiwan or China, with Taiwanese tools tending to be much more reliable than ones made in China.

Once the lever rotates past parallel with the press, the diameter of the tool changes the point of force. This reduces the length of the lever arm and will mess up your torque calculation.
